How To Make Turnip and Cauliflower Mash Recipe
Creamy and flavorful mashed turnips and cauliflower, a perfect substitute for mashed potatoes!
Preparation: 10 minutes
Cooking: 20 minutes
Total: 30 minutes
Serves:
Ingredients
- 1 medium turnip, peeled and cubed
- 1 small head of cauliflower, roughly chopped
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ter
- 1/4 cup heavy cream
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
-
Place turnip cubes, cauliflower, and garlic cloves in a pot and cover with water.
-
Bring to a boil over high heat and simmer for 10-15 minutes, or until vegetables are tender.
-
Drain vegetables and return them to the pot.
-
Add butter and heavy cream to the pot and mash with a potato masher until smooth.
-
Season with salt and pepper to taste.
